The method of bacteriological diagnosis of colienteritis is quite lengthy and painstaking. A positive test result can be obtained no later than the fourth day. In addition, when viewing 8-10 colonies from Endo's medium by an approximate agglutination reaction on glass with specific sera, you can skip exactly the colony that will give a positive reaction. Therefore, the development and application of accelerated methods of laboratory diagnosis of colienteritis is very relevant for the timely implementation of anti-epidemic measures and the correct etiopathogenetic treatment of patients.
